We’ve personally explored 7 beaches in Phuket, evaluating sand quality, ideal visitors, and whether they’re worth a special trip—here’s the ultimate guide👇
**Racha Yai (Batok Bay) | Powder-Soft Sands 🏖️🐚**
Batok Bay on Racha Yai is stunning—its sand is as fine as "flour," pristine white, and blissfully soft underfoot✨. Though small, this beach excels in privacy and tranquility. The water is a mesmerizing glassy blue, so clear you can spot fish swimming beneath🐠. Perfect for sunbathing or portrait photography, every shot turns out postcard-worthy📸.
**Racha Yai (Siam Bay) | A Dawn Sanctuary for Solitude 🌅🧘♀️**
Siam Bay feels like a dreamy escape🌙, especially at low tide when the expansive shoreline is nearly empty👣. The sand is fine but mixed with coral fragments🪨, giving a gentle massage underfoot. The water shimmers in soft blue-green hues🌊, creating a serene backdrop for photos. Ideal for couples or travelers seeking solitude.
**Racha Yai (East Bay) | Snorkeling Paradise for Early Risers🐟🌄**
East Bay is a snorkeler’s paradise🤿, with crystal-clear waters and breathtaking sunrises💘. At low tide, the smooth white sand emerges, but high tide brings coarser grains and dark debris. Snorkeling here is popular but never overcrowded, making it perfect for underwater photography📷.
**Karon Beach | Windswept and Wild 💨🏄♂️**
Karon Beach is all about freedom💥, with a long coastline and strong winds ideal for surfing, jogging, or daydreaming. The sand is coarser near the road (watch for pine needles🍂), but softer by the water. On sunny days, the sea glows electric blue💙, great for landscape or portrait shots. Lively yet never cramped.
**Nai Harn Beach | Moody but Photogenic 🌥️📷**
Under cloudy skies, Nai Harn Beach feels subdued☁️. The coarse sand is less comfortable😅, and crowds peak in the afternoon, making it tricky to avoid photobombers👫. Best for casual strolls, not dedicated photography or snorkeling.
**Rawai Beach | Rustic Charm Over Sand Quality ⛵🌅**
Rawai isn’t for swimming—it’s a launchpad for island-hopping boats🚤. The sand is rough with broken shells👣, and the air carries a briny tang from fishing boats. Yet, its working harbor offers unique "slice-of-life" photo ops📸, especially at sunset.
**Banana Beach | Effortless Island Joy 🍌🏝️**
Banana Beach is stress-free perfection🎉—just a 30-40 minute boat ride to powdery beige sand and calm, clear waters👡. Great for snorkeling newbies, with loungers🪑, showers, and food options. Pure relaxation without the hassle💛.
